		<description><![CDATA[Grey and yellow is the &#8220;it&#8221; color combination in textiles. Sadly, these colors don&#8217;t mix well with my pale complexion so I needed to find another way to enjoy them. Try pairing up a grey vase with yellow flowers, a grey votive with a yellow one, or a grey couch with yellow pillows.]]></description>
